Key Responsibilities
- Maintain cleanliness throughout the store and facilities.
- Clean and sanitize showers and restroom areas.
- Handle laundry tasks including washing, loading, and unloading towels.
- Carry out routine repairs and maintenance in the store.
- Collect and dispose of trash around the travel center.
- Deliver exceptional customer service by ensuring well-kept facilities.
Qualifications and Skills
- Self-motivated individuals ready to work proactively.
- Team players comfortable collaborating with others.
- Capable of lifting up to 50 pounds and standing or walking for most of the day.
- Flexible availability to work nights, weekends, holidays, and different shifts.
- Preferred: Previous experience in a janitorial or maintenance role.
- Preferred: Basic knowledge of industrial equipment with the ability to troubleshoot minor issues.
Compensation and Benefits
- Hourly wages start between $15.00 and $21.10.
- Weekly pay cycles.
- 15 cent per gallon fuel discount.
- Free daily meals for team members.
- Affordable health insurance plans at $10 for full-time employees.
- Paid time off and family leave options.
- Additional programs including wellness initiatives, reward and recognition, professional development, 401(k) retirement savings plan, and adoption assistance.
